Default You're gonna love this story!

Nashville Tennessean had an ad for an '07 Z06 with 9,400 miles, 2LZ package with the notation MUST SELL back on 7/13. It had a Memphis, TN, phone number and a note to text or call for more info. The price was $20,000.00! Sent two texts, called four times, on that Saturday, no response until Wednesday and I get a text from Judith Henderson offering to send photos if I wanted them. DO I EVER!! I get an email with six photos and the car looks great, black with gray interior, mileage on odometer agrees with the ad. "Judith" has just gotten a divorce and doesn't need the car.

So I send a reply - It looks like you're in Memphis. I can be there in 4 hours with cash or cashier's check. No reply. Send another message - where's the car?? Your phone is Memphis but the background scenery looks like California (I knew that because there is a Kilroy Realty sign in the background of one of the photos and they are strictly West Coast). Finally get a message back that she wanted to start over, moved to Omaha, NE, the car is in a shipping container ready to go to its new home. I can pay with Google Wallet without worry since they won't release the money to her until I give them the go ahead to do so.

So I send a note back - no need to ship. There is a flight on Friday from Nashville that puts me in Omaha at 11:09 and I can drive the car home and be back by midnight. And again, I'll bring 200 $100.00 bills or a cashier's check. Just let me know which you prefer.

All this has to be on the up and up - right?

I haven't heard anything else from "Judith". I probably missed out on the deal of the decade. Whaddaya think?

It's tongue in cheek. Of course it's a ripoff. All the warning signs are there - no personal contact, can't come see the car, wants to use Google Wallet for payment, and more.

I have a friend who also contacted Judith at the Memphis # (via text). The ad was in the Knoxville paper. He offered to come pick the car up and got a response that the car was in Nebraska, and that she was currently traveling and would ship the car with a 5 day approval money back guarantee. The money would be held by google or someone to assure a fair deal. For those who have looked carefully at the picture of the car, the sign in the background is for a San Francisco real estate company. This car gets around. He asked for directions to come pick up the car and never got another response.
